Gram, a manufacturer of energy efficient refrigeration equipment, has launched a brand new educational micro site 'Go green with Gram' that is specifically aimed at caterers looking for helpful advice on how they can increase the efficiency of their operations.
The online micro site offers visitors the chance to learn about the wealth of incentives that are open to operators looking to go green. In addition, the site offers clarification on the use of the Energy Technology List, as well as downloadable resources from Gram such as 2008's Green Paper, the new Keep your Cool brochure, and an FAQ section with the 'Green Doctor' himself, Glenn Roberts. Glenn Roberts, managing director at Gram UK, commented: "The foodservice industry is increasingly becoming aware of the impact it can have on the environment. With green issues high on everyone's agenda, it becomes the responsibility of manufacturers to take the first step, lead the way in educating operators on ways they can reduce their impact, and contribute to a greener future. "This resource is just one of the many initiatives that we as a business are undertaking in a bid to give operators the tools and the information they need to make the right choices." www.gogreenwithgram.com
